The Penthouse: War in Life is heating up the small screen day after day. Like all the works of writer Kim Soon Ok from Temptation of Wife to The Last Empress that ŌĆ£you curse as you watch,ŌĆØ The Penthouse: War in Life makes viewersŌĆÖ hair tingle with its provocative topics and developments. Then why on earth do we still watch Kim Soo OKŌĆÖs works? LetŌĆÖs take a look at the key features that often appear in ŌĆ£Soonok KimŌĆÖs Universe.ŌĆØ #One Hell of a Makjang Development Along with Im Sung Han, Kim Soon Ok is the first writer that comes to mind when it comes to ŌĆ£makjang dramas.ŌĆØ And The Penthouse: War in Life also boasts its ŌĆ£spicyŌĆØ plot. These are the topics that appeared in just 4 episodes: affair, kidnapping, murder, disposing of the body, secrets behind birth, admission corruption, school violence, and domestic violence.

#Mad Presence of Villains Shin Ae Ri from Temptation of Wife and Yeon Min Jung from Jang Bo-Ri Is Here! Writer Kim is the one who gave birth to these ŌĆ£all-timeŌĆØ villains. Her outstanding portrayal of villains is still quite impressive. Villains from The Penthouse: War in Life, let it be adults or kids, radiate such ŌĆ£evilnessŌĆØ to the point where we think ŌĆ£there is not a single person in her right mind.ŌĆØ And among them all, Cheon Seo Jin and Joo Dan Tae are the ŌĆ£main villains.ŌĆØ However, compared to the female villains who have shown jaw-dropping presence in Kim Soon OKŌĆÖs previous works, the impact left by Cheon Seo Jin is relatively weak. But this is mostly because Joo Dan TaeŌĆÖs psychopathic aspects are too magnified. ┬Ā #Parents Separated from Their Child One of KimŌĆÖs favorite subjects is the storytelling of biological parents and their children being separated and failing to recognize each other. In The Penthouse: War in Life, there is a tragic secret of birth between Shim Soo Ryeon and Min Seol Ah. Min Seol Ah is a child born between Shim Soo Ryeon and her ex-husband, but she was adopted to the U.S. by Joo Dan TaeŌĆÖs scheme. Somehow, Shin finds out that Min is her own daughter, but she has already passed away by then.

#Hardships that Every Character (from Main, Supporting to Child Roles) Go Through Ā Most characters in ŌĆ£Soonok KimŌĆÖs universeŌĆØ go through various challenges and hardships. And this fate doesnŌĆÖt avoid main, supporting, or child roles. And this ŌĆ£traditionŌĆØ remains the same in The Penthouse: War in Life. Not to mention the two main characters Shim Soo Ryeon and Oh Yoon Hee, but families living in the penthouse and Min Seol Ah, who died in the first episode, already had or will have to endure the coming hardships. ┬Ā #Tragedy Caused by Fire or Car Accidents ŌĆ£FireŌĆØ and ŌĆ£car accidentsŌĆØ are another favorite topics used by writer Kim. These incidents are used as sources for the main characters to pledge revenge while also being used as the ŌĆ£weaknessŌĆØ for the villains. In The Penthouse: War in Life, all parents from the penthouse except Shim Soo Ryeon dumped Min Seol AhŌĆÖs body in an apartment and set it on fire to disguise her death as a suicide. This incident, which seemed to have concluded as a perfect crime, starts a new problem when a watch left by Lee Kyu Jin comes into the hands of Shim. Their effort to ŌĆ£cover-upŌĆØ the incident became the villainsŌĆÖ weakness.

#Kind Protagonists Become Revenger Of all the characters in the drama, Shim is the only ŌĆ£goodŌĆØ person. And there is a good reason why such a kind-hearted person turns into a vengeful person. It will be strange to see her continue to be an ŌĆ£angelŌĆØ even after going through such horrible things in her life, such as learning the truth behind her ex-husband and her daughterŌĆÖs death and figuring out the affair between Joo Dan Tae and Cheon Seo Jin. Her moves so far are reminding viewers of Shin Deuk Ye from My Daughter, Geum Sa-wol. ┬Ā #A Fresh Start of Villains Most of the villains in KimŌĆÖs works saw a miserable end, but nevertheless, some showed remorse for their past sins. Kim In Hwa from Jang Bo-ri Is Here! and Goo Sae Kyung from Band of Sisters are the best examples. And there are two characters in The Penthouse: War in Life that are showing similar paths: Joo Dan TaeŌĆÖs son Joo Seok Hoon and Cheon Seo JinŌĆÖs husband Ha Yoon Chul. However, with the charactersŌĆÖ intertwined relationships, itŌĆÖs still uncertain if these two characters will show ŌĆ£complete rehabilitation.ŌĆØ ┬Ā #Resurrection of Those Who Were Believed to Be Dead Starting with Goo Eun Jae from Temptation of Wife, there were people who ŌĆ£resurrectedŌĆØ from their death to either personally solve or act as the key figure in putting an end to the case. As of the 7th episode, three people are dead: Min Seol Ah, Shim Soo RyeonŌĆÖs ex-husband and Joo Dan TaeŌĆÖs secretary Yoon Tae Joo. And since only Yoon Tae JooŌĆÖs death wasnŌĆÖt confirmed, viewers are expecting him to show up again and give hands to Shim in her revenge. ┬Ā Editor Yang Young Jun: There is at least one good part in every movie or TV series.
